Waldeinsamkeit!
Du [grünes]1 Revier,
Wie liegt so weit
Die Welt von hier!
Schlaf nur, wie bald
Kommt der Abend schön,
Durch den stillen Wald
Die Quellen gehn,
Die Mutter Gottes wacht,
Mit ihrem Sternenkleid
Bedeckt sie dich sacht
In der Waldeinsamkeit,
[Gute Nacht,]2 Gute Nacht! -

Musical settings (art songs, Lieder, mélodies, (etc.), choral pieces, and other vocal works set to this text),
listed by composer (not necessarily exhaustive)
by Henk Bijvanck
, "Waldeinsamkeit", 1957, from 2 liederen, no. 2. ![[setting text needs to be verified]](/images/ball.red.gif)
by Karl Collan (1828-1871)
, "Waldeinsamkeit" [voice and piano] ![[setting text needs to be verified]](/images/ball.red.gif)
by Robert Kahn (1865-1951)
, "Waldeinsamkeit", op. 21 (Vier Duette mit Klavier) no. 1 (1893), published 1895. [duet for high and low voice with piano] ![[setting text needs to be verified]](/images/ball.red.gif)
by Egon Kornauth (1891-1959)
, "Waldeinsamkeit", op. 37 (Sechs Lieder nach Eichendorff) no. 4 (1932). [high voice and piano] ![[setting text needs to be verified]](/images/ball.red.gif)
by Benjamin Wilhelm Mayer (1831-1898)
, "Waldeinsamkeit", op. 1 (Drei vierstimmige Gesänge für gemischten Chor a cappella) no. 2 [chorus a cappella], under the pseudonym W. Rémy ![[setting text needs to be verified]](/images/ball.red.gif)
by Anton Grigoryevich Rubinstein (1829-1894)
, "Waldeinsamkeit", op. 76 (6 Lieder) no. 1. [voice and piano] ![[setting text needs to be verified]](/images/ball.red.gif)
by Othmar Schoeck (1886-1957)
, "Waldeinsamkeit", op. 30 no. 1 (1918). ![[setting text verified]](/images/ball.green.gif)
by (Julius August) Philipp Spitta (1841-1894)
, "Waldeinsamkeit", 1860. ![[setting text not yet verified]](/images/ball.white.gif)
by Erich J. Wolff (1874-1913)
, "Waldeinsamkeit", op. 14 (Vier Gedichte von Eichendorff) no. 2, published 1907. [voice and piano] ![[setting text verified]](/images/ball.green.gif)
